mortality/aging
• most postnatal lethality of mice with a paternal allele occurres around P4
• Background Sensitivity: survival is enhanced in M. m. castaneus cross

cellular
• abnormal imprinting of Igf2 occurs with mice receiving the maternal allele having increased growth rates in utero while mice receiving the paternal allele having decreased in utero growth rates

embryo
• severe growth retardation is seen at E13 through birth in mice inheriting a paternal allele
• placental weight ratios are more severely reduced than fetal weight ratios with mice inheriting a paternal allele

craniofacial
• mice inheriting a paternal allele exhibit a domed head phenotype

growth/size/body
• mice inheriting a paternal allele exhibit a domed head phenotype
• severe growth retardation is seen at E13 through birth in mice inheriting a paternal allele
• at birth, size of mice inheriting a paternal allele is less than 50% of normal
• adults with a paternal allele are only about 60% of the weight of wild-type littermates
• postnatal growth is also reduced in mice inheriting a paternal allele, with weight reaching a minimum at about 4 days of age

mortality/aging
• while the expected number of mice inheriting the paternal allele are present at E18, by P1 only one third of expected mice are present

cellular
• abnormal imprinting of Igf2 occurs with mice receiving the maternal allele having increased growth rates in utero while mice receiving the paternal allele having decreased in utero growth rates

embryo
• at E13 mice carrying a paternally inherited allele are 83% of wild-type in weight
• at E13 placental weight is 78% of wild-type and reaches 56% of wild-type at E18 in mice carrying a paternally inherited mutant allele
• with embryos inheriting a maternal allele

growth/size/body
• at birth mice carrying a paternally inherited allele are 55% of wild-type in size
• at birth, mice carrying a paternally inherited allele are 53% of wild-type weight
• in mice carrying a paternally inherited allele the size reduction observed at birth is maintained into adulthood
• mice inheriting maternal allele measure 113% of wild-type and overgrowth reaches 108% of wild-type by P0
• mice inherting maternal allele have increased prenatal growth rates
